Warning Signs You Need Insulation Water Damage Restoration

Don’t ignore these warning signs, which can show serious issues with your insulation: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ors can be a sign of mold growth, which can spread quickly and cause health issues. If you notice persistent musty smells, it’s time to call our team for a thorough inspection and restoration.

Water Stains and Warping

Water stains and warping can show water damage, which can compromise your insulation and structural integrity. Don’t delay – our team is ready to assess and restore your insulation.

Increased Energy Bills

If your energy bills are skyrocketing, it may be a sign of damaged insulation. Our team can inspect and restore your insulation to ensure your property is energy-efficient and safe.

Unusual Noises and Creaks

Unusual noises and creaks can show structural damage or compromised insulation. Our team is ready to assess and restore your insulation to prevent further damage.

Visible Signs of Water Damage

Visible signs of water damage, such as water spots, mineral deposits, or warping, can show serious issues with your insulation. Don’t delay – our team is ready to inspect and restore your insulation.

Insulation Water Damage Restoration Cost In Argyle, TX

The cost of Insulation Water Damage Restoration in Argyle, TX, varies based on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ates range from $500 to $2,500, depending on the scope of the project. Factors that affect the cost include: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water removal and drying $500-$1,500 Size of affected area, water volume, and equipment required
Insulation replacement and repair $1,000-$3,000 Type and quality of insulation, size of affected area, and labor required
Sanitizing and dehumidifying $200-$1,000 Size of affected area, type of sanitizing products used, and labor required
Final inspection and certification $100-$500 Complexity of the project, number of inspections required, and certification fees
Emergency services and response $100-$500 Time of day, severity of the situation, and equipment required
More services (mold remediation, structural repairs) $500-$2,500 Scope of the project, equipment required, and labor involved
